Starting A Successful Fitness Program By Mike Freemen When it comes to starting a successful program, perhaps the most important step is the decision to get started. It can be difficult to start a program, but simply getting started can be very important. There are many ways to start a program, whether on your own or with the assistance of a trainer.
One of the first decisions to make when deciding on a program is what kind of equipment you will purchase. There are many different kinds of equipment for sale at a variety of different retailers, including stair steppers, treadmills, elliptical trainers and exercise bikes. Any one of these pieces of equipment can provide an excellent workout, and it is important to choose the equipment that you will use on a regular basis.
Of course not every program will require the purchase of special equipment. A program can be as simple as a daily walk or jog, but it is important for the exerciser to work out on a regular basis, and not to let the enthusiasm of the early days be lost as time goes by.
While exercise is an important part of any program, it is also important to eat a good and a healthy diet. A good diet is an essential element of any program, and a good diet can help people lose weight, gain muscle and increase overall fitness. Eating a good diet means getting plenty of fruits and vegetables, limiting the intake of saturated fat and basically watching what you eat.
